Prelert Names John O'Donnell as CFO
"John's expertise will help Prelert become an even more agile competitor," said CEO Mark Jaffe.

Prelert, a provider of machine learning anomaly detection, announced John O’Donnell has joined the company as chief financial officer. In this role, he will manage all financial, legal, human resources and administrative operations, working directly with Prelert’s senior management team to drive growth and success in each area.
“John’s financial leadership experience and track record of increasing value for technology companies is the perfect fit for Prelert, especially as the demand for our security and IT operations software continues to grow,” said Mark Jaffe, Prelert’s CEO,in a press release “John’s expertise will help Prelert become an even more agile competitor – and will help ensure that our critical finance and administrative operations grow in lockstep with our success.”
With more than 20 years of industry experience, O’Donnell most recently served as CFO of Aveksa, a leading provider of business-driven identity and access management software.

While there, he built a global finance and administration organization to support the company’s dynamic growth, leading to its eventual acquisition by EMC Corporation. Prior to that, he served as the controller for both Empirix, a provider of real-time, end-to-end test, monitoring and analytics solutions and Netegrity, a provider of identity and access management that was acquired by CA Technologies. In both roles, O’Donnell was responsible for directing all accounting, tax, risk management, internal control, financial planning, analysis and international operations.
“Today, cybersecurity is more than just a concern of IT professionals – it’s vital to the health of entire companies – and worried about at the executive level. With the increasing risks that cyberattacks pose, real-time anomaly detection, like Prelert’s, is the only way to discover breaches and mitigate significant data loss,” said O’Donnell, in a written statement. “I’m thrilled to be part of an expanding company dedicated to keeping businesses aware of and ready to act on these threats.”

O’Donnell holds a BBA in accounting from the Isenberg School of Management at the University of Massachusetts, Amherst.
Prelert is a provider of machine learning anomaly detection for IT security and operations teams. The company is located on Speen Street in Framingham
